Background of Common Problems Owners Face

Construction projects are often marred by a host of challenges that can significantly impact the quality, cost, and timeline of a project. In Bali, where tourism is the backbone of its economy, building structures that not only meet aesthetic standards but also functional requirements has become increasingly important. However, many owners face common issues such as delays, budget overruns, substandard materials, and poor workmanship.

Delays in Construction Projects

One of the most pervasive problems faced by project owners is the delay in construction timelines. Delays can occur due to various factors, including inadequate planning, unforeseen site conditions, supply chain disruptions, weather events, and regulatory compliance issues. For instance, a study conducted by McKinsey & Company found that on average, construction projects experience delays of 19 months, with an overrun rate of up to 85%. These delays not only impact the project's completion date but also lead to increased costs.

Budget Overruns

Budget overruns are another critical issue that owners must address. According to a report by the National Institute of Building Sciences (NIBS), approximately 90% of construction projects in the United States experience cost overruns, with an average increase of about 35%. In Bali, where material costs can be volatile due to trade tensions and local economic factors, this risk is even higher. For instance, a study by Skanska found that around 62% of project owners experienced budget overruns, leading to financial strain and reduced profitability.

Substandard Materials and Workmanship

The use of substandard materials and poor workmanship can severely impact the quality and durability of a structure. In Bali, where natural disasters such as earthquakes are a concern, ensuring that buildings meet high standards is paramount. A report by the Construction Industry Research and Information Association (CIRIA) highlighted that poor construction practices can result in buildings with an average life expectancy of only 20 years instead of the expected 50 to 70 years. This not only leads to higher maintenance costs but also poses a significant safety risk.

Poor Quality Control

Poor quality control processes often exacerbate these issues, leading to repeated corrections and rework. A study by the Construction Industry Institute (CII) found that up to 41% of construction costs are spent on correcting poor workmanship and material defects. In Bali, where local labor practices can vary widely in skill levels, this issue is particularly acute.

Regulatory Compliance Issues

Compliance with building codes and regulations is crucial but often overlooked by project owners. A failure to meet these standards can result in legal penalties, fines, and even the forced demolition of structures. According to a report by the International Council for Local Environmental Initiatives (ICLEI), non-compliance with local building codes can cost developers up to 10% of their total construction budget.
